comparemela.com

Top Locations Tagged with Fresh Air Ports

Fresh Air Ports in Canada - /Hair-salon near Point Leamington

1). Fresh Hair

Fresh Air Ports in India - 110005/Commercial-industrial near Central Delhi

2). Fresh Air Pvt Ltd Delhi India

vimarsana © 2020. All Rights Reserved.